Security - Roles vs Custom Property

What is the difference from creating additional roles to manage security for groups of users vs creating a custom property to manage a group of users?  In the help file it suggests creating a custom property user type like Developer, Contributor, and Consumer.  Is there any difference in functionality in doing this than creating additional roles?

1 Solution

Accepted Solutions
Not applicable
Author

It's a great question.  I think the way to consider the difference in the scenario you highlight is:

With roles you can have one to many relationships between a user and roles (one user can have many roles).

With custom properties you have one to one relationships between a user and a property (one user can have one value from a given property).

So if your environment has a scenario where a user may be a developer in some areas and a consumer in others than a role based methodology using Security Rules is a better way to go.

Note that in the later versions of Qlik Sense (2.1 and up I think) there is a one-to-many relationship from resources (e.g. users) to custom properties.
